Question 755841: A hospital staff mixed a 75% disinfectant solution with a 25% disinfectant solution. How many liters of each were used to make 25L of a 35% disinfectant solution?

Let +a+ = liters of 75% solution needed
Let +b+ = liters of 25% solution needed
+.75a+ = liters of disinfectant in 75% solution
+.25a+ = liters of disinfectant in 25% solution
-------------------
given:
(1) +a+%2B+b+=+25+
(2) +%28+.75a+%2B+.25b+%29+%2F+25+=+.35+
-----------------------------
(2) +.75a+%2B+.25b+=+.35%2A25+
(2) +.75a+%2B+.25b+=+8.75+
(2) +75a+%2B+25b+=+875+
Multiply both sides of (1) by +25+ and
subtract (1) from (2)
(2) +75a+%2B+25b+=+875+
(1) +-25a+-+25b+=+-625+
+50a+=+250+
+a+=+5+
and, since
(1) +a+%2B+b+=+25+
(1) +5+%2B+b+=+25+
(1) +b+=+20+
5 liters of 75% solution are needed
20 liters of 25% solution are needed
check:
(2) +%28+.75a+%2B+.25b+%29+%2F+25+=+.35+
(2) +%28+.75%2A5+%2B+.25%2A20+%29+%2F+25+=+.35+
(2) +%28+3.75+%2B+5+%29+%2F+25+=+.35+
(2) +8.75+=+.35%2A25+
(2) +8.75+=+8.75+
OK
